TechFlow reported on October 9 that CryptoQuant analyst Burak Kesmeci pointed out the average cost of short-term Bitcoin holders is playing a crucial role. Currently, the average cost for holders with 1-3 months of holding period stands at $61,633, while for those holding 3-6 months it is $64,459. These two levels are converging daily, and the breakout direction will be decisive.
Kesmeci believes that if the price breaks above $64,500, it would provide strength to the bulls; conversely, if it falls below the 1-3 month holder average cost of $61,600, the patience of Bitcoin investors will face a severe test.
